01What is being requested

Disposal of clean and reusable soil (classified as Agriculture/nature, class Residential or class Industrial) originating from soil depots or municipal projects. The assignment will be executed via a new Dynamic Purchasing System (DPS) with a term from 13/01/2026 to 23/03/2034.

05Award criteria

Most economically advantageous tender or Lowest priceweight n/a

Assignments are awarded on the basis of the most economically advantageous tender based on the best price-quality ratio, unless the award criterion of quality is not applicable. Criteria may be the lowest price or quality, for example planning and sustainability.

11Frequently asked questions

What classifications can the offered soil have?
The soil is classified as Agriculture/nature, class Residential or class Industrial.
What is the origin of the soil?
The soil originates from soil depots managed by the Municipality of Amsterdam or from municipal projects where the soil has been definitively inspected.
How is the disposal of the soil arranged?
The Municipality of Amsterdam is establishing a new Dynamic Purchasing System (DPS) for the disposal of the released soil.
Are sustainability criteria applied?
Yes, sustainability criteria are applied to this assignment.
